Sure, any machine will do but..... case in point..... The Gold Bug 2. It will certainly "pop" on silver coins. But rusty nails, white metal, tin foil, and others will get thrown into the mix. I don't particularly favor displays but when "cherry picking" specific metals, the machines with displays have their purpose. I have three display machines. I am favoring the Cortez right now. I would not think of looking for coins with my GB2 unless prepared to spend a lot of time digging trash with the coins. ╦╦Ç
